Webb2016). The rise in knife crime is not a new phenomenon. Between 1997 and 2005, the number of people admitted to hospital reportedly following an assault involving a sharp object rose by 30% in England (Maxwell, Trotter, Verne, Brown, & Gunnell, 2007). Between 2014 and 2016, knife crime in London rose by 16% (Johnston, 2016).
